-1

ウィンドウやラベルなどに四角形を描くのが好きですが、メインウィンドウに収まるようにサイズを小さくするのが好きです。500x300 のサイズから始めるには、ドッキング ウィンドウについて考えます。長方形のサイズは、たとえば 4100x130 または 2800x2070 にすることができますが、それはほとんど画面からはみ出してしまいます。私が望むのは、ウィンドウのサイズを変更することであり、長方形もサイズ変更して、ウィンドウに収まるようにする必要があります。これどうやってするの?qt-4.8.4 を使用し、opengl もインストールされています。22 年前に DOS 用のプログラムを作成しましたが、今では Linux で動作するはずです。だからqtは私にとって新しいものです。

4

1 に答える 1

0

[削除された例]

私の例は別の質問でした。私は私の質問を少し違った方法で解決したからです。上記の私の質問をよりよく説明します

みんなのパソコンの画面サイズがわかりません。したがって、ウィンドウをどれだけ大きくするかはユーザー次第です。ウィンドウのサイズが 600x400 だとしましょう。そして今、私は 4000x1300 の何かを描画したいと思っています。したがって、600x400 の小さなウィンドウに収まるようにスケーリングする必要があります。問題ありません。しかし、ユーザーがウィンドウのサイズを大きくすると、図面のサイズも大きくなる可能性がありますが、今理解しているように、情報が欠落しています。3 ポイントの長さの線があり、5 ポイントの長さになるように引っ張ると、元の線には 3 ポイントの情報しかないので、どこかから 2 ポイントを追加する必要があります。4100x1300 の図面全体をどこかに保存し、そこから自分のウィンドウにスケーリングすることはできますか? ウィンドウのサイズが大きくなると、保存された画像の新しいスケーリングされたコピーが作成されますか?

于 2013-02-08T17:29:50.563 に答える